Macedon, Eion, (c.460-400 B.C.), silver trihemiobol, (11mm, 0.76 g), obv. Goose standing right, head left, above, lizard curving left, H to lower right, rev. quadripartite incuse square, (cf.S.1295, SNG ANS 291 var (H to upper right), HGC 3.1, 521, SNG Copenhagen 179). Toned, some porosity, very fine and very scarce.
Ex Anthony "Tony" Taylor Collection.^CNG 395, lot 41. From the W. H. Guertin Collection.^
